Situated in southeastern Pennsylvania, Lancaster is known for its rolling farmland, hand-crafted Amish goods, horse and buggies, and laid-back lifestyle. However, Lancaster is also home to a vibrant downtown district brimming with diverse eateries, eclectic boutiques, charming coffee shops, and local markets in well-preserved historic buildings along brick-lined streets.
With a focus on historic preservation, Lancaster offers an array of historic sites and architecture, including 57 landmarks listed on the National Register of Historic Places. As a renter in Lancaster, you can see where James Buchanan lived at Wheatland, or get a taste for the artistic side of the city by enjoying a world-class performance at the American Music Theatre. First Fridays, Fulton Opera House, Pennsylvania College of Art and Design, and several galleries downtown are all available to residents and visitors alike.
